JsonToAccess工具:将Json文件转换为Access数据库
需积分: 5 133 浏览量
更新于2024-11-25
收藏 5.95MB ZIP 举报
资源摘要信息:"JsonToAccess_jb51.zip"
在当今数据驱动的世界中,将数据从一种格式转换为另一种格式是一个常见的需求。JsonToAccess_jb51.zip这个资源包,正如其名称所暗示的,提供了一个将JSON文件转换成Microsoft Access数据库文件的解决方案。为了深入理解这个资源包的相关知识点,我们将从以下几个方面进行探讨:
1. JSON基础知识
2. Access数据库简介
3. JSON与Access数据库的转换过程
4. JsonToAccess_jb51.zip的使用方法和场景
5. 常见的JSON转Access的工具和方法
6. 转换过程中的注意事项
### 1. JSON基础知识
J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,易于人阅读和编写,同时也易于机器解析和生成。JSON是基于文本的,完全语言无关,但使用了类似于C语言家族的语法。JSON数据格式可以描述两种结构:
- 对象(Object):一个对象被定义为一组有序的键值对。每个键后面跟着一个冒号(:),键值对之间使用逗号(,)分隔。整个对象使用大括号({})括起来。
- 数组(Array):数组是值的有序集合。一个数组以方括号([])表示,数组中的值可以是任意类型。
JSON广泛用于Web应用的数据交换,特别是在Web服务中传递数据,因为它比XML更小、更快。
### 2. Access数据库简介
Microsoft Access是微软发布的一个关系数据库管理系统,它包含在一些Office套件版本中。Access提供了一个可视化的用户界面,允许用户方便地操作数据库,创建表、查询、报表和表单,以及运行宏和编写VBA代码。
Access数据库文件通常具有扩展名“.mdb”或“.accdb”,它们存储在单个文件中,这种文件结构便于小型数据库的部署和共享。Access特别适合中小型企业应用,以及需要快速开发简单应用程序的场景。
### 3. JSON与Access数据库的转换过程
将JSON数据转换为Access数据库的过程涉及到几个关键步骤:
- **解析JSON文件**:首先需要解析JSON数据以识别其中的数据结构和内容。
- **设计Access数据库模式**:根据JSON数据结构设计Access数据库表的结构,包括字段名称、数据类型等。
- **数据导入**:将解析后的JSON数据填充到Access数据库中相应的表和字段中。
- **验证和调整**:在数据导入后,进行必要的验证,确保数据的准确性和完整性,并根据需要调整数据库结构或数据。
### 4. JsonToAccess_jb51.zip的使用方法和场景
使用JsonToAccess_jb51.zip资源包,用户可以通过以下步骤来转换JSON数据到Access数据库:
- 解压缩JsonToAccess_jb51.zip文件。
- 根据资源包内的文档说明或使用向导,导入JSON数据到指定的工具中。
- 选择或创建对应的Access数据库文件,并指定数据导入路径。
- 运行转换工具,等待转换完成。
- 验证Access数据库文件,确保转换的数据正确无误。
这个资源包特别适合于以下场景:
- 需要将Web服务的数据导入到本地数据库中进行进一步分析和处理。
- 开发者需要快速将JSON格式的数据用于测试或演示目的。
- IT专业人员处理来自第三方的数据,需要将JSON数据整合到内部系统中。
### 5. 常见的JSON转Access的工具和方法
除了使用JsonToAccess_jb51.zip之外,还有其他方法和工具可以用来将JSON转换为Access数据库:
- **编程语言内置功能**:某些编程语言如Python、JavaScript(Node.js)提供了将JSON转换为其他格式(如数组、对象)的库和模块。
- **在线工具**:网络上有许多免费或付费的在线工具可以直接将JSON文件上传,然后导出为Access数据库文件。
- **数据库管理系统自带工具**:一些数据库管理系统提供工具或接口支持JSON格式数据的导入导出。
- **编写自定义脚本**:利用VBA、Python等编程语言编写脚本,解析JSON并创建Access数据库文件。
### 6. 转换过程中的注意事项
在进行JSON转Access的过程中,需要注意以下几点:
- **数据类型一致性**:确保JSON中的数据类型与Access数据库中的字段类型相匹配,例如字符串、日期、数字等。
- **数据结构兼容性**:JSON结构可能包含嵌套对象或数组,需要合理地映射到Access表中的关系。
- **字符编码**:确保JSON文件的字符编码与Access数据库兼容,避免出现乱码问题。
- **数据完整性**:在转换过程中,确保数据没有丢失或错误地转换。
- **性能优化**:对于大型JSON文件,转换过程可能会消耗较多资源,应当考虑性能优化。
总之,将JSON文件转化为Access数据库是一个涉及多种技术和步骤的过程。JsonToAccess_jb51.zip提供了一个便捷的解决方案,使得这一过程变得简单快捷。无论是开发人员还是数据库管理员,了解相关的知识点将有助于更有效地实现数据格式转换,满足业务需求。
2021-04-20 上传
2021-03-15 上传
2021-03-18 上传
2020-09-18 上传
2020-06-13 上传
2020-02-28 上传
2020-01-02 上传
2021-06-19 上传
haoran_2023
- 粉丝: 0
- 资源: 7
最新资源
- 正整数数组验证库:确保值符合正整数规则
- 系统移植工具集:镜像、工具链及其他必备软件包
- 掌握JavaScript加密技术:客户端加密核心要点
- AWS环境下Java应用的构建与优化指南
- Grav插件动态调整上传图像大小提高性能
- InversifyJS示例应用:演示OOP与依赖注入
- Laravel与Workerman构建PHP WebSocket即时通讯解决方案
- 前端开发利器:SPRjs快速粘合JavaScript文件脚本
- Windows平台RNNoise演示及编译方法说明
- GitHub Action实现站点自动化部署到网格环境
- Delphi实现磁盘容量检测与柱状图展示
- 亲测可用的简易微信抽奖小程序源码分享
- 如何利用JD抢单助手提升秒杀成功率
- 快速部署WordPress:使用Docker和generator-docker-wordpress
- 探索多功能计算器:日志记录与数据转换能力
- WearableSensing: 使用Java连接Zephyr Bioharness数据到服务器